The Age | Gay men receive apology more than 30 years after homosexuality decriminalised The Age Peter McEwan was just 17 when the police caught him caressing another man behind some bushes on Brighton beach in 1967. It was enough for him to receive a criminal conviction while he was still finishing year 12. Premier Daniel Andrews issues a ... A person celebrating gay pride is wrapped in a rainbow flag.
